How Long to Bake a 15 Pound Ham

Baking a ham involves calculating cooking time based on its weight in pounds to achieve safe internal temperatures and optimal texture. For a 15 pound ham, this typically means 2.5 to 4 hours, depending on whether it's fully cooked or uncooked. Accurate timing prevents overcooking or undercooking, essential for holiday meals or large gatherings where food safety is key.

Understanding Ham Baking Times

Ham cooking guidelines use weight as the primary factor, measured in pounds (lb), with time output in minutes or hours. Fully cooked hams (most common, like smoked varieties) require 10-15 minutes per pound at 325°F (163°C). Uncooked hams need 18-20 minutes per pound or more. These rates ensure the internal temperature reaches 140°F (60°C) for fully cooked hams or 160°F (71°C) for raw ones.

The formula is straightforward:

Total time (minutes) = Weight (pounds) × Minutes per poundHow Long to Bake a 15 Pound Ham

Convert minutes to hours by dividing by 60 if preferred for planning.

Step-by-Step Calculation for a 15 Pound Ham

  1. Identify ham type:Assume fully cooked bone-in ham, using 12 minutes per pound as average (adjust for boneless at 10 minutes or spiral-cut at 13-15 minutes).
  2. Apply formula:15 lb × 12 min/lb = 180 minutes.
  3. Convert to hours:180 ÷ 60 = 3 hours. Bake at 325°F, covered with foil for the first 2 hours to retain moisture.
  4. Check doneness:Use a meat thermometer; remove at 140°F. Let rest 15-20 minutes.
  5. Unit conversions if needed:For metric recipes, convert pounds to kilograms (1 lb ≈ 0.4536 kg), so 15 lb = 6.8 kg. Oven temps: 325°F = 163°C.

Practical Applications and Tips

In home cooking, engineers scaling recipes for events, or students learning food science, weight-to-time conversions streamline prep. For international users, convert lb to kg or °F to °C seamlessly. Daily use includes meal planning where precise timing avoids dry meat.

Common mistakes to avoid:

  • Ignoring ham type—always check packaging.
  • Forgetting altitude adjustments (add 20-25% time above 3,000 ft).
  • Not tenting with foil, leading to drying out.
  • Skipping thermometer—visual cues mislead.

Final Notes

To bake a 15 pound ham perfectly, aim for 10-15 minutes per pound at 325°F, totaling about 3 hours for fully cooked types, confirmed with a thermometer. This method ensures juicy results every time.
